Ader: Books and Photographs - First American Editions from 1890 to 2019

Auction Reports

Auction Name Books and Photographs - First American Editions from 1890 to 2019 Total Sales (EUR) 21,257.50
Auction Date November 27, 2025 - November 27, 2025 Low Estimate of Lots Sold (EUR) 17,560.00
Sale Number #171461 High Estimate of Lots Sold (EUR) 25,930.00
Total Lots 146
Sold Lots 91.0 Low Estimate of All Lots (EUR) 28,360.00
% of Lots Sold 62.33% High Estimate of All Lots (EUR) 41,100.00
Unsold Lots 55 Total Sales as a % of High Est. 51.72%

Top twenty-five by sale price

Lot Number Author Name Book Title Year Published Estimate Actual Price
127 SOTH, ALEC (1969)

Broken Manual. By Lester B. Morrison & Alec Soth.

2010 EUR 800.00 - 1,200.00 EUR 2,000.00
75 FRANK, ROBERT (1924-2019)

Flower Is.

1987 EUR 2,000.00 - 3,000.00 EUR 1,875.00
28 FRANK, ROBERT (1924-2019)

The Americans.

1958 EUR 1,000.00 - 1,500.00 EUR 1,000.00
27 KLEIN, WILLIAM (1926-2022)

New York. Life is Good and Good For You in New York: Trance Witness Revels.

1956 EUR 1,000.00 - 1,500.00 EUR 875.00
26 STEICHEN, EDWARD (1879-1973) [Signed]

The Family of Man.

1955 EUR 200.00 - 300.00 EUR 712.50
40 LYON, DANNY (1942)

The bikeriders.

1968 EUR 400.00 - 600.00 EUR 650.00
3 HINE, LEWIS W. (1874-1940)

Men at Work.

1932 EUR 600.00 - 800.00 EUR 625.00
4 MAN RAY (1890-1976)

Man Ray. Photographs 1920-1934. Paris. With a portrait by Picasso - Texts by Andre Breton Paul Eluard Rrose Selavy Tristan Tzara

1934 EUR 800.00 - 1,200.00 EUR 625.00
10 ABBOTT, BERENICE (1898-1991)

Changing New York.

1939 EUR 300.00 - 400.00 EUR 575.00
106 SOTH, ALEC (1969) [Signed]

Sleeping the Mississippi,

2004 EUR 200.00 - 400.00 EUR 512.50
36 LEVITT, HELEN (1913-2009)

A Way of Seeing. Photographs of New York by Helen Levitt with an Essay By James Agee.

1965 EUR 300.00 - 400.00 EUR 425.00
71 AVEDON, RICHARD (1923-2004)

In the American West 1979-1984.

1985 EUR 200.00 - 300.00 EUR 425.00
67 GRAHAM, PAUL (1956) [Signed]

A1. The great north road.

1983 EUR 200.00 - 300.00 EUR 412.50
63 FRIEDLANDER, LEE (1934) [Signed]

Flowers and Trees.

1981 EUR 400.00 - 600.00 EUR 375.00
11 LANGE, DOROTHEA (1895-1965)

An American Exodus. A Record on Human Erosion.

1939 EUR 200.00 - 300.00 EUR 350.00
37 EVANS, WALKER (1903-1975)

Many Are Called.

1966 EUR 200.00 - 300.00 EUR 350.00
51 WINOGRAND, GARRY (1928-1984)

Women are Beautiful. With an essay by Helen Gary Bishop.

1975 EUR 300.00 - 400.00 EUR 325.00
113 SAUL LEITER (1923-2013)

Early Color.

2006 EUR 150.00 - 200.00 EUR 325.00
124 FRIEDLANDER, LEE (1934) [Signed]

America by Car.

2010 EUR 200.00 - 300.00 EUR 325.00
47 ADAMS, ROBERT (1937)

The New West. Landscapes Along the Colorado Front Range.

1974 EUR 300.00 - 500.00 EUR 312.50
64 SHORE, STEPHEN (1947)

Uncommon places. Photographs by Stephen Shore.

1982 EUR 300.00 - 400.00 EUR 300.00
24 DE CARAVA, ROY (1919-2009) HUGHES, LANGSTON (1902-1967)

The Sweet Flypaper of Life.

1955 EUR 200.00 - 300.00 EUR 287.50
44 ARBUS, DIANE (1923-1971)

Diane Arbus.

1972 EUR 120.00 - 180.00 EUR 287.50
83 SULTAN, LARRY (1946-2009) [Signed]

Pictures from Home.

1992 EUR 200.00 - 300.00 EUR 262.50
35 CALLAHAN, HARRY (1912-1999)

Photographs.

1964 EUR 300.00 - 400.00 EUR 250.00
